This course, presented by Jim Rigos of Rigos Professional Education Programs, satisfies the annual CMA ethics requirement.
Jim Rigos is an attorney-CPA who has written and lectured widely in accounting, ethics, and legal topics. He graduated from Boston University Law School and has served on the AICPA's Accountants Liability committee. He is presently a National Director of the American Association of Attorney-CPAs.
Rigos Professional Education Programs is a leading international provider of programs designed to prepare individuals for professional legal and accounting licensing examinations such as the BAR, CPA, and CMA-CFM exams. They also offer professional ethics and legal liability courses for CPAs, CMAs and business enterprises.
